Rubber-Toughened Adhesives for OEM Assembly



DANVERS, MA - ZipGrip® rubber-toughened adhesives from Devcon are ideal for OEM assembly applications that require rapid curing, gap filling, or the bonding of dissimilar substrates. These high-viscosity, clear-drying cyanoacrylates effectively bond plastics, rubber, and metal. Easily dispensed by hand or with automatic equipment, they provide exceptional flexibility and impact resistance and can withstand service temperatures up to 280° F.

Because they attain fixture strength in seconds, rubber-toughened ZipGrip adhesives eliminate the need for fixturing. Functional strength (80% of maximum) is attained in 60 minutes and full cure in 24 hours. ZipGrip rubber-toughened adhesives comply with military specification MIL-A-A-3097, Type II, Class 3.

With a viscosity of 1200 cps, ZipGrip HV1200 is ideal for bonding porous substrates and filling gaps to .008". Tensile shear strength (on steel) is 3700 psi. It can be used for audio speaker assembly, PCB wire tacking, and affixing gaskets or weather stripping to metal. It can also be used to bond wood, cork, and leather.

With a higher viscosity (2200 cps), ZipGrip HV2200 fills gaps to .050". Resistant to water, humidity, and extreme thermal shock, it has a higher tensile shear strength (3800 psi on steel) and is ideal for the assembly of automotive trim, air and oil filters, disk drives, and other products.

For selected OEM applications, Devcon can custom mix cyanoacrylate adhesives to meet specific customer requirements for working time, cure time, viscosity, and color.
